World Cruise of the Samuel B. Roberts DD 823. Cold War tensions were high when Atlantic Fleet Destroyer Division 101 slipped out of its homeport of Newport, Rhode Island to reinforce the Pacific Fleet in its mission off Korea. There were four ships in the division: Samuel B. Roberts DD823, Brownson DD868, Forest Royal DD872, and Charles H. Roan DD853. Operating in the Pacific meant patrolling the Korean coast, rescuing fliers, towing targets for aircraft, fueling at sea, highline transfers, practicing Anti-Submarine Warfare (ASW), Shore Bombardment, Torpedo Attacks and all the other tasks assigned to destroyers. After completing their mission in the Pacific, the four ships continued westward to complete a circumnavigation of the world. They crossed the Equator, and showed the flag in Hong Kong, Manila, Philippines, Sri Lanka, and ports in the Middle East. They then continued on through the Suez Canal, and called on Naples, Italy, the French Riviera, Barcelona Spain and stopped in the Azores, before returning to Newport. This is the story of that world cruise.
